Easy hiking trails around Dubeninki are set within Poland's Warmian-Masurian Voivodeship, a region characterized by its pristine natural landscapes. The area features the expansive Romincka Forest, a diverse forest and heath landscape, and numerous lakes, including Poland's deepest, Lake Hańcza. Gentle hills and varied forest compositions of spruce, oak, and pine define the terrain, offering accessible routes for outdoor exploration.

The bridges in Stańczyki, often called the "Aqueducts of the Romincka Forest," are among the highest railway bridges in Poland – 180 meters long and reaching a height of 36.5 meters. Built between 1912 and 1918 in a style reminiscent of Roman aqueducts, they were intended to be part of a major railway line, but the line operated only as a local route until 1945. Today, the tracks no longer exist, and the impressive structures have become a tourist attraction and a bungee jumping site. Situated on the Błędzianka River and surrounded by picturesque scenery, they are a destination for bicycle tours and a good place to rest. Admission to the bridges is charged, but the view and history of the site are definitely worth a visit.

The observation tower in Stańczyki is an interesting point on the Green Velo Eastern Cycling Trail. The wooden and steel structure is 20 meters high, and from the platform at a height of 15 meters you can admire the railway bridges in Stańczyki, the Błędzianka Valley and nearby lakes. The tower is accessible all year round and is located right next to an asphalt road, so you can easily get there by bike.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many easy hiking trails are available around Dubeninki?

Dubeninki offers a wide selection of easy hiking trails, with over 30 routes specifically categorized as easy. In total, there are 76 hiking tours in the region, catering to various skill levels.

What kind of landscapes can I expect on easy hikes in Dubeninki?

Easy hikes around Dubeninki lead through diverse and pristine natural landscapes. You'll primarily explore the expansive Puszcza Romincka (Romincka Forest), characterized by varied trees like spruce, oak, and pine. The region also features numerous scenic lakes, including the notable Lake Hańcza, Poland's deepest lake, and gentle hills.

Are there any family-friendly easy hikes in Dubeninki?

Yes, many of the easy trails are suitable for families. For instance, the Stańczyki Bridges loop from Błąkały is a short 1.5 km route, perfect for a quick family outing to see the impressive bridges. The Stańczyki Bridges – Observation tower in Stańczyki loop from Błąkały is a slightly longer 3.4 km option that also includes an observation tower, offering engaging views for all ages.

What are some notable landmarks or attractions to see on easy hikes?

The most iconic landmarks are the Stańczyki Bridges, often called the 'Aqueducts of the Romincka Forest,' which are impressive railway viaducts. You can explore them on routes like the Stańczyki Railway Viaducts loop from Błąkały. Other points of interest include the Stańczyki Observation Tower and the serene Hańcza Lake.

Are there any circular easy walks available?

Absolutely. Many easy trails around Dubeninki are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point. Popular circular routes include the Stańczyki Bridges loop from Błąkały and the Oz Turtul Observation Tower loop from Bachanowo, which offers a longer, easy walk.

What do other hikers say about the easy trails in Dubeninki?

The easy hiking trails in Dubeninki are highly regarded by the komoot community, with an average rating of 4.7 stars from over 70 reviews. Hikers often praise the tranquility of the Romincka Forest, the picturesque views of the Stańczyki Bridges, and the well-maintained paths that make for a pleasant and accessible outdoor experience.

What is the best time of year for easy hiking in Dubeninki?

Dubeninki is appealing for hiking throughout much of the year. Spring and autumn offer pleasant temperatures and beautiful foliage, especially in the Romincka Forest. Summer is ideal for enjoying the lakes, while winter provides opportunities for cross-country skiing and serene, snow-covered landscapes, though some trails might require appropriate gear.

Are there any easy trails that offer views of lakes?

Yes, the region is dotted with numerous lakes. While not directly on an easy komoot route listed here, the Hańcza Lake, Poland's deepest, is a significant natural feature nearby with an educational trail along its eastern shore. The Picnic Area by Vištytis Lake – Wisztyniec Sacred Spring loop from Čižiškiai offers easy access to lake views and a sacred spring.

Can I find places to eat or stay near the easy hiking trails?

While Dubeninki itself is a tranquil area, the nearby town of Gołdap offers additional amenities, including spa facilities and green spaces, which might include cafes or restaurants. For specific recommendations, it's best to check local listings in Dubeninki or Gołdap.

Are there any easy trails that lead to an observation tower?

Yes, the Stańczyki Bridges – Observation tower in Stańczyki loop from Błąkały is an easy 3.4 km route that specifically leads to an observation tower, providing elevated views of the surrounding landscape and the impressive Stańczyki Bridges.

What kind of terrain should I expect on easy hikes in Dubeninki?

The easy hikes in Dubeninki generally feature gentle terrain with minimal elevation changes. You'll mostly encounter forest paths, some heathland, and trails around lakes. The region is characterized by its varied forest composition and gentle hills, making for comfortable walking surfaces suitable for beginners and those seeking a relaxed outdoor experience.

Are there any historical sites accessible via easy trails?

The most prominent historical sites are the Stańczyki Bridges, which are early 20th-century railway viaducts. Several easy routes, such as the Stańczyki Bridges loop from Błąkały, offer direct access to these architectural marvels. Additionally, the Old Believers' Molenna in Wodziłki is another historical religious site in the broader region.
